Output 65ae66a205753ab90f1b376f5c4dc0011fb45c1d6b1be9021df65c8d3c20c287:1

value
6561803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2817d10b39cfecb27fa2b8f854ce6231ba2a84d1 OP_EQUALVERIFY OP_CHECKSIG
address
14ezZUj7PWySLGe26A7KsMJEfHsuwkbsXk
transaction
65ae66a205753ab90f1b376f5c4dc0011fb45c1d6b1be9021df65c8d3c20c287
spent
true